BENNCH began with two sisters, Neha and Naina Chaudhary, and a shared belief that getting dressed doesn’t have to fit neatly into categories.
The name BENNCH comes from benchmark, a reflection of our ambition to create our own standard for elevated everyday clothing. The double N is a little nod to the two of us: two perspectives, two personalities, two ways of seeing the world, brought together into one brand.

And then came Otouto.
If BENNCH is the more expressive sibling, Otouto is its softer side.
Otouto was born from the same design language, but with a different rhythm. Exclusively created in woven fabrics, it is more relaxed, fluid and feminine, clothing that feels easy on the body while retaining the thoughtfulness that defines BENNCH.
The name itself means younger sibling in Japanese, and that is exactly how we see it: not a separate story, but another expression of the same one.
